Inclusion criteria
Inclusion criteria: Patients of diabetes mellitus type 2 Age group 40-70 years All patients of non proliferative diabetic retinopathy (NPDR) with diabetic macular edema Patient willing to give written informed consent and willing to participate in study.
Exclusion criteria
Exclusion criteria: Any ocular pathology obscuring the Optical Coherence Tomography (OCT) imaging Presence of any other ocular disease or posterior segment disorder like glaucoma, uveitis, Age Related Macular Disease or any vascular occlusive disease affecting macula. Treated with laser photocoagulation Received intravitreal antiVEGF injection in preceding 6 months Patients with poorly controlled blood sugar levels Patients who do not follow up after at least 1 month following intravitreal antiVEGF injection Not able to perform YBP in YBP group Any lung disease like chronic obstructive pulmonary disease (COPD), asthma Patient with chronic kidney disease Any intraocular surgery in past 1 year Patients with past history of posterior segment surgeries or any history of past ocular trauma. Unwilling and uncooperative patient
